HTML5 The final standard is just a fleeting feast.

Source: Internet
Author: User
Keywords Html5 apicloud
The author of the paper: Apicloud Mobile Applications Cloud Services founder and CEO Liu HTML5 is only a technical standard, but now more bearing the ideal of subversion of Apple and Google Mobile ecology. I do not want to talk about the real situation of HTML5 from a technical point of view, because technology never becomes the absolute bottleneck of development, especially the HTML5 itself does not have any major technical problems. Instead, commerce became an insurmountable chasm in HTML5 development. Unfortunately, business has always been a mixture of speculative elements and, of course, commercial politics. HTML5 's so-called standard finalization is just a hoax and a public show. The HTML5 standard is not a single place for the organization, nor is it the only spokesperson. It was not until 2022 that the publication of the HTML5 official standard was enacted, why was it so hastily finalized? How much impact will this kind of finalization have on mobile development? Public secrets and grudges the people who are really concerned about HTML5 will remember a major news story of the July 2012, with HTML5 's two standard organizations and WHATWG, who parted because of the idea of disagreement, was seen as a commercial political event in the IT world. The fundamental difference between the two is that WHATWG thinks HTML5 should be a dynamic standard Livingstandard, while the consortium thinks that it should form a fixed standard. The real reason for this escalation is not the simplicity of the idea, but the driving force behind the interest groups that each represents. WHATWG to the consortium, it is from Mozilla, Apple and opera support. The consortium chose Microsoft. The HTML5 standard itself involves no obstacles to the technology, but the reason for the delay has been complicated, slow progress in addition to proving that these organizations are super inefficient institutions, the so-called interests and business political game is the real cause of slow progress. In fact, as of 2013 more than 90% of the HTML5 standards have been completed, the rest is precisely the major interest groups game focus, this is the voice of the Mehujael, a great deal of meaning, this really will work? Of course not! Because the major gold Lord will not because of a PR activity to give up their own interests. Although WebApp and Nativeapp who died and who live the issue has been debated for a long time, but the PR activities of the consortium, for those who look forward to carrying the banner of the HTML5 to subvert the app ecology, and repeat the trick of a liar fooled fool. So what does it mean for developers and technology users to make the so-called standard decision? Can you benefit from it? How do we look at this progress? All this has to do with the divergence between the WHATWG and the other, dynamic standards or fixed standards more suitable for developers? I think the answer may be WHATWG's livingstandard!. Because there is no dynamic standard, there will be no HTML5 of the future. HTML5 want real development in the future, the core issue is not the standard day or browser performance is not enough, the key is two points, one is continuous improvement, the second is the ecology. Continuous improvement If there is no continuous improvement of the standards and efforts to the organization, HTML5 can only subvert the app ecology as a slogan, always acting as a supporting role. Because the pace of ecological innovation is much larger than the speed of developers. ITWorld has been completely not 10 years ago, cloud/client cloud and end quickly eroded the traditional B/s architecture (browser to the server) space. The end of the mobile phone is not specified, but more extensive including the pad end of the PC and even the end of the car end home appliances and so on. In contrast to the PC era, more side appearance represents more hardware combinations and more business scenarios and functions. We have been criticized for the slow pace of standards organizations such as the US, and the announcement of this standard clearly does not solve any cloud-and-end complexity. Let's imagine: Scene A; the TouchID of the iphone is emerging on a variety of terminals, resulting in a large number of new APIs, and even possible future terminal capabilities with hard solutions, such as iris recognition, voice print recognition, and so on, under a fixed HTML5 standard. HTML5 with the Deviceapi even only covers the Featurephone era of the basic Address Book, camera and other functions, today's TouchID can not be effectively mobilized, not to mention 2, 3 years after we can not recognize the new function of the standard supporting implementation. In this case, the HTML5 standard represents a weak feature scenario B: the development of smart hardware is rapidly increasing the demand for Bluetooth and WiFi usage and drivers, and what is the support standard for Bluetooth 3.0 drivers for HTML5? Can you follow standard HTML5 or matching standards and protocols to connect most of your smart hardware to your browser? The answer, of course, is totally negative. One of the most common of the future is not possible, and those who talk about HTML5 will replace the app may say that these are not HTML5 good examples. So what HTML5 is good at is typesetting layout and reading class also or some Low-cost game app? Not to mention that for NFC, and so on may soon become the terminal standard system new ability, therefore the HTML5 standard which does not develop after the finalization represents the weak expansion in fact, all this is based on the HTML5 argument is not no clear solution, in short, the so-called HTML5 finalization is only farce and PR, If you really look forward to HTML5 Challenge app ecology, there must be a continuous development of the dynamic standards, to be able to have the eligibility to participate in the game. But it depends on the standard behind the push and the king, those who want to build their own ecological kingdom of the big players. As an important pillar of WHATWG, Apple has been developing its own webapp technology in a low-key, and so far, iOS has more than Android and otherThe system is more mature and perfect HTML5 support, but unfortunately Apple is only HTML5 as a technology, but not to build HTML5 ecological make any other efforts. The ecological 2013 is the lowest HTML5 year, because in the previous year, numerous blows ensued, in addition to users of HTML5 generally negative feedback, the most serious incident is Facebook's total water! Once upon a time, faced with HTML5 Zuckerberg's ambitious push to replicate Facebook's eco-and Hegemony program on the PC side. As we all know, Apple's ecosystem is quite closed, although Android is open but it also replicates Apple's ios-developer-app-appstore-user. So Facebook is pushing HTML5 to jump open the mobile operating system and embrace the HTML5 and WWW open traffic system. But even Facebook's heavyweight players have finally recognized it. Even Zuckerberg's grief over the media, and the biggest mistake we've ever had was to gamble too much on HTML5! , coincidentally, LinkedIn as another vane, in 2013 also gave up the HTML5 to embrace the app again. To this day, is not a short span of more than a year, the world has undergone a radical change, HTML5 and regain the temperament of the king? Of course it is impossible, all the world's it kingdoms have not changed, change is only time. According to Flurry's report, the user's share of app usage on the mobile side increased further by 80% in 2014 compared with last year, while the use of mobile web sites was further squeezed. This shows that the user market is not as difficult as the app upgrades and downloads (at least not as difficult as you think), and as the App Store is more humane and intelligent to help users automatically upgrade in the WiFi environment and so on, app in the use of the threshold for users is getting lower, Instead, the use and acquisition of WebApp based on HTML5 has become a barrier to users. Mobile browser user retention and use of more and more pessimistic, the most important HTML5 carrier is losing vitality, but we hope that the Super app, micro-letter in China is now a lifeline. Of course, companies that build their own closed-loop ecosystems based on the Super app are not just Facebook, but also a large number of domestic test-water firms, but all end with Jankin. From the WebApp store in UC to the lightweight application of Baidu, building an ecosystem based on mobile web traffic has not been successful. There are many reasons for this situation, such as poor browser performance, HTML5 standards, no effective webapp distribution channels, and so on, but as I said 3 years ago, the core issue is the confrontation between the mobile open flow system and the native ecosystem. Users are currently searching and downloading apps from the App Store, and the app portal is on the desktopClick to use, which has become a fixed mode for iOS and Android ecosystems. Instead, let the user into the Super app, and then through the search or connect to a Third-party WebApp, whether from the operating process or the user's final experience can not compete with the operating system level experience. And the HTML5 standard is not for this ecological difficulties bring any change, so said HTML5 in the so-called standard version of the final, just a PR farce, although stirred the market, but also stimulated a group of practitioners to serve as cannon fodder. Of course, HTML5 and WebApp not to open or micro-letter! Creating mobile open platforms and ecosystems, micro-trust is the leader, and has successfully transformed part of the app's traffic into WebApp traffic. Micro-letter has also innovated the way of diversion, did not choose User URL input, also did not choose User Search into the WebApp, but the account into the URL and direct collection of ways, formed a special WebApp browser. After getting through the flow and appropriate to join the payment means, not only to activate the flow also make the flow more valuable. This gives hope to HTML5 developers, but is quickly disappointed, as developers find that micro-letters control the flow of traffic beyond expectations. This reminds me of the SNS era open platform to play dead many socialgame manufacturers of the past. China has a large Internet open platform, once Tencent, everyone even Taobao. But the summary rule is not a Pixiu principle flow only can not enter, the so-called activate flow only for own ecological service, although this is understandable, just for developers to put their dream grafting in China version of the open platform is tantamount to tiger. So the HTML5 ecology may be built on an open platform, but the HTML5 that really can fight the native ecosystem needs more radical changes like webOS. Summing up the developer's final version of the HTML5, the mentality can be very calm and will not bring any substantial changes in the short term. browsers, especially operating system vendors, will not give up their own interests because of the finalization of the standard, which has already been supported and should not be supported by standards. Just HTML5 as a progressive standard, aside from the game of interest and politics, still will bring more value to the developer. As long as not blindly follow the attitude of learning to actively treat, will still benefit from it. HTML5 and supporting web development technology has a cross-platform, low threshold of the characteristics of the current large number of applications in the application of HTML5 with nativedevelopment native development, greatly reducing the overall development cost of the app, There are a number of mobile application engines that use JavaScript and HTML5 to develop Cross-platform Nativeapp to play a practical value without touching the ecological benefits of iOS and Android. So as long as the return to the technology itself, the application of HTML5 technology to practical scenarios to give full play to value, we can gradually meet the brighter future. There have been many professional mobile application development platforms for Web developers in the mobile domain, such as APPCELERAOTR, PhoneGap, Apicloud, Kony, Appery, etc., which accelerates the popularization of HTML5 practicality, Let HTML5 technology combine mobile to play greater business value. Of course, in addition to the app, there are some HTML5 game Professional support technology platform, such as Cocos2d's jsbinding and many other HTML5 game engine, for HTML5 and JS and other Web technologies in the current ecological environment of the application provides an effective way. So it can be said that the developers in the HTML5 technology itself in the choice of homeopathy to become the key to development and benefit. (This article for the author Liu Contributions, the manuscript point of view does not represent the point of view) on the author: Chinese name Liu, apicloud mobile application Cloud service founder and CEO, witnessed the China Mobile Internet from the SP Dream Network to the era of the whole process of the intelligent machine. Focus on domestic and foreign mobile application development Platform field research, systematically elaborated the challenge of web app and the development of hybrid app. And with the Apicloud.com mobile application cloud services to successfully get the Northern lights of the 5 million U.S. dollar a round of financing.
Related Article

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.